Warning Signs You Need Kitchen Water Damage Restoration in the Area
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Keep an eye out for these warning signs to prevent further damage: Act fast to avoid bigger problems.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ors in your kitchen can show moisture issues.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s time to call us. Don’t ignore the signs.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Water stains on your walls, ceiling, or floors can be a sign of underlying damage. If you notice any discoloration, don’t delay – call us right away. We’ll address the issue before it gets worse.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to call us. We’ll assess and repair the damage.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ture issues. If you notice any changes in your walls, don’t ignore it – call us right away. We’ll fix the problem before it gets worse.
Increased Humidity or Mold Growth
High humidity or mold growth in your kitchen can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your kitchen’s environment, don’t delay – call us. We’ll address the issue before it causes more problems.
Electrical Issues or Leaks
Electrical issues or leaks in your kitchen can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any problems with your electrical system or plumbing, don’t ignore it – call us right away. We’ll assess and repair the damage.
Kitchen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ill with no structural damage |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small spills, but be sure to act fast to prevent further damage. |
| Water damage with structural issues (e.g., warped flooring) | No | Yes | Structural issues need profess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
| Water damage with mold growth | No | Yes | Mold growth needs professional removal to prevent health risks and further damage. |
| Water damage with electrical issues | No | Yes | Electrical issues need professional attention to prevent electrical shock and further damage. |
| Water damage with extensive damage (e.g., multiple rooms) | No | Yes | Extensive damage needs professional attention to ensure a thorough restoration process. |

Kitchen Water Damage Restoration Cost in Howe, TX
The cost of Kitchen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ment. We’ll work with you to understand your needs and provide a customized quote.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and type of cleaning required |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Extent of structural damage and materials needed |
| Equipment Rental and Use | $100 – $500 | Duration of equipment rental and usage |
| Inspection and Testing | $100 – $500 | Frequency and complexity of testing |
| Insurance Claims Help | $0 – $500 | Complexity of claims process and frequency of communication |
